Development of the Fundamental Subject "Strength of Materials" Using Modern Computer Programs
Izaicinājumi inženierzinātņu augstākajā izglītībā 2021
Svetlana Sokolova, Olga Kononova, Juris Kalinka

One of the most important study courses in technical education is "Strength of Materials". Due to the development of computer programs and new technologies, it is necessary to adapt the study course to modern computing technologies based on the finite element model (FEM). Using bars, beams or shells as examples, students are shown the essence of FEM using Solidworks or ANSYS programs, building on the basic concepts of the Strength of Materials course.
